Product Data Sheet

3,4-Di-O-acetyl-L-rhamnal

Catalog No. A91900

main product photo
3,4-Di-O-acetyl-L-rhamnal is a biochemical assay reagent that serves as a substrate for various enzyme-catalyzed reactions. This compound is utilized in the study of glycosylation processes and in the investigation of carbohydrates' role in biological systems. Its application extends to assessing enzyme activity and profiling glycosyltransferases in life science research.
Chemical Information
Catalog NumA91900
M. Wt214.22
FormulaC10H14O5
Purity>98%
Storageat -20 °C 3 years (powder form); at -20 °C 6 months (Solution base)
CAS No.34819-86-8
Synonyms3,4-Di-O-acetyl-6-deoxy-L-glucal
SMILESCC(O[C@@H]1[C@H](C=CO[C@H]1C)OC(C)=O)=O
